About a week ago I completed a new website for the Wahroonga BeautySpot beauty salon.
The new website was the 3rd phase of a complete branding revamp I have been performing for the salon, with the first and second phases being a new logo design and new price list and brochures respectively.

Something that is often overlooked when building a web-site is optimisation of content. It’s one thing to design a web site that looks great… and it’s another thing to have it function efficiently so that users are able to learn as much about you in as little time possible. This is where web optimisation comes into play.
